A Black Husky innovation, this double IPA is brewed with high alpha hops and locally harvested spruce tips. Like Lothar the Biter, this beer has an aggressive biting flavor with a pungent yet citrusy aroma.

    Had the opportunity to have this fresh from Tim's keg in Pembine. After he showed us the source of the spruce needles (right outside the brewery) he generously poured a sampling of his pride and joy. Pours a hazy, ridiculous coloured orange. Nose is beautiful. Yeasty, floral and fresh. Taste is agressive spruce flavors, big but balanced bitterness (how do you like that alliteration?).

    Alright, I admit it. I like beers that taste like Pinesol, but believe me when i say this, this one doesnt. Its got a good spruce flavor but not one with a chemically spruce flavor. This has a nice head and good lacing and layers of flavor like a good amber or layered ipa. Being a double ipa its got a nice kick too it and after their pale ale, this is my favorite.
